How to Get a Malware Analyst Job: Key Skills, Responsibilities and Salary

A malware analyst, also known as a reverse engineer or a threat researcher, is a cybersecurity professional specializing in the analysis of malicious software (malware). Their primary role is to dissect, understand, and document the behavior, capabilities, and impact of different types of malware. Responsibilities of a malware analyst typically include:

1. Malware Detection and Identification:

Malware analysts analyze suspicious files or network traffic to identify and classify malware. They use various tools, techniques, and knowledge of malware behaviors to detect and differentiate between different types of malware.

2. Malware Analysis:

Malware analysts perform in-depth analysis of malware samples to understand their inner workings. This includes static analysis of the code, reverse engineering, examining file structures, and analyzing behavior in controlled environments. They aim to identify the malware’s purpose, capabilities, infection vectors, and potential impact on systems or networks.

3. Threat Intelligence and Research:

Malware analysts stay updated on the latest malware threats, attack techniques, and vulnerabilities. They conduct ongoing research to discover new malware strains, analyze attack campaigns, and track evolving malware trends. This information helps in improving detection capabilities and developing effective mitigation strategies.

4. Incident Response and Forensics:

Malware analysts often play a vital role in incident response and forensic investigations. They analyze malware samples collected during security incidents, identify the root cause of the compromise, and provide insights into the attacker’s activities. Their findings contribute to developing incident response plans and strengthening defensive measures.

5. Tool Development and Automation:

Malware analysts may develop custom tools or scripts to assist in automating the analysis process. These tools help in handling large volumes of malware samples efficiently, extracting relevant information, and generating reports.

6. Collaboration and Reporting:

Malware analysts work closely with other cybersecurity professionals, such as threat intelligence analysts, incident responders, and security researchers. They collaborate to share knowledge, insights, and indicators of compromise (IOCs) to enhance collective defenses. Malware analysts also produce reports detailing their analysis findings, which can be shared internally or externally to raise awareness and aid in defense against malware threats.

The salary of a malware analyst can vary depending on factors such as location, experience, skills, industry, and the employing organization. Salaries can also be influenced by the level of demand for skilled malware analysts in the job market.

1. Entry-Level Malware Analyst:

In the early stages of their career, a malware analyst can expect an annual salary ranging from $50,000 to $80,000 USD.

2. Mid-Level Malware Analyst:

With a few years of experience and a solid skillset, a mid-level malware analyst can earn between $80,000 and $120,000 USD per year.

3. Senior Malware Analyst/Lead:

Seasoned malware analysts with several years of experience, expert knowledge, and leadership responsibilities can earn salaries in the range of $120,000 to $180,000 USD or higher.

It’s important to note that these figures are approximate and can vary based on factors mentioned earlier. Additionally, salaries can differ across industries, with cybersecurity companies, government agencies, and large organizations often offering higher compensation packages.

To get a good malware analyst job, individuals typically need a strong understanding of programming languages, operating systems, network protocols, and malware analysis tools. They should have expertise in reverse engineering techniques, familiarity with security frameworks, and a continuous learning mindset to keep pace with rapidly evolving malware landscape.
